Durability

In comparison to traditional front doors composite doors are significantly less prone to crack or warp or fade. This is due to the fact that they are constructed with a GRP layer that resists UV rays and weathering. Composite doors are also energy-efficient, reducing heating costs and environmental impact.

They will require some maintenance. Avoid excessive force such as slamming a door. This could damage the internal mechanisms, making it stick. It is an excellent idea to encourage family members to shut the door with care. It is also a good idea for you to wash the hinges and door with warm water using a soft cloth. This will help keep the door in good shape and get rid of any dirt that may have accumulated over time.

Like any other exterior door Composite doors are vulnerable to rainwater and draughts. To avoid problems like this you must regularly check and replace your weather seals. This will keep the inside of your home dry and warm by preventing cold air from entering your home and allowing moisture to seep into. It is also important to grease your hinges with light oil to prevent them from slipping or sagging.

Another common issue is a stuck lock. This happens when dust and dirt accumulate in the locking mechanism, making it become stiff or difficult. In this situation you can try lubricating the lock mechanism using a product specifically designed for door locks and locks. If the issue continues it is possible to alter some of the internal components of the lock, like the deadbolt and latch.

Maintenance

Composite doors are extremely durable, but they do require some care. In addition to regular cleaning, you must also look for dents or cracks and repair them promptly. This will extend the life of your door and make it look like new.

To keep your composite door looking its best, you should regularly clean it with an easy cloth and warm soapy water. Avoid using abrasive or steam cleaners since they could damage your black composite door scratch repair door. It is also important to dry your door and the hardware immediately after cleaning, to prevent watermarks and corrosion.

If you're concerned about the appearance of your composite doors, you might consider hiring a professional to polish them for you. This will not only make your composite door repair near me door look new, but also help protect it against the elements. A good polishing can bring back your composite door to its original shine and will aid in preventing scratches, stains and marks better.

Another common problem that you might have to deal with when using your composite door is the gaskets and seals that seal the weather getting dislodged. This is especially likely in Leicester as the weather can be quite extreme throughout the year. This could lead to water getting into your home through the gaps. To prevent this from happening, you should examine and clean your door's drainage system and, if needed, re-insert the gaskets and seals for weather sealing.

It is also recommended to regularly check and re-insert your door handles, letter plates, spy holes, numbers and knockers to ensure they are secure. To lubricate the composite door parts and reduce friction, WD-40 or 3in-One is a good choice. You can also make use of an lubricant made of Teflon that is more effective at cutting down on wear and friction.
